King Charles and Queen Camilla have issued a statement saying they have been left "dreadfully saddened" by the earthquake in Colombia.A 7.4 magnitude tremor hit the South American country at 7.34am local time (12.34pm GMT) on Monday, with an epicentre in San José del Palmar, the US Geological Survey (USGS) said.At least 224 people have died, while approximately 3,000 individuals remain missing, making it the country's deadliest quake this century.Following the widespread devastation, His Majesty The King released an official statement on social media, addressing "the people of Colombia".
